Tom Brady: The GOAT's Rise to Fame
Before we delve into Tom and Gisele's yoga journey, let's quickly revisit Tom's incredible football career.
Thomas Edward Patrick Brady Jr., born on August 3, 1977, in San Mateo, California, is widely regarded as one of the greatest quarterbacks in NFL history. Drafted by the New England Patriots in 2000, Brady went on to lead the team to an unprecedented six Super Bowl wins, earning the title of GOAT (Greatest of All Time). His impressive record of 225 consecutive games with a touchdown pass and 581 career touchdown passes speak volumes about his unparalleled skills and dedication to the sport.
Gisele Bündchen: A Supermodel's Reign
Now, let's shine the spotlight on Tom's stunning wife, Gisele Bündchen. Born on July 20, 1980, in Horizontina, Rio Grande do Sul, Brazil, Gisele is an international supermodel who has graced numerous magazine covers and walked the runway for top fashion houses. She was the first Brazilian model to achieve international success and has been credited with helping to "bring the glamour back to the runway" in the late 1990s and early 2000s.
